Crime overview

Lambrook Street area has the 5th highest crime rate of 54 local areas in Glastonbury , and the 90th highest crime rate of 1,847 local areas in Somerset .

Neighbouring streets tend to have noticeably higher crime levels than this postcode. Crime here is lower than the average for the surrounding output areas.

The overall crime rate in the area around Lambrook Street (BA6 8BY) in the last 12 months was 310.9 per 1,000 residents and was 94.8% higher than the Glastonbury average (159.6 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 36 offences recorded. The least common crime was Robbery with 1 case , up 100.0%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Robbery ( 100.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Other theft ( -60.0%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 48 (≈ 201.7 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were falling ( -4.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-61.6%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around Lambrook Street (BA6 8BY), the highest concentration of overall crime is near Supermarket, where police recorded 89 incidents. Violent and public-order offences occur most often near Lambrook Street (38 offences). Both locations lie within roughly 0.3 miles of this postcode area.
